Position Overview You will perform functional logic verification of integrated SoCs to ensure designs meet specifications. This includes defining and developing scalable and reusable block, subsystem, and SoC verification plans, test benches, and verification environments to meet required coverage levels and confirm to microarchitecture specifications.

You'll execute verification plans and define and run emulation and system simulation models to verify designs, analyze power and performance, and uncover bugs. Working in the presilicon environment, you'll replicate, root cause, and debug issues while finding and implementing corrective measures to resolve failing tests.

Collaboration is key as you'll work with SoC architects, microarchitects, full chip architects, RTL developers, postsilicon, and physical design teams to improve verification of complex architectural and microarchitectural features. You'll document test plans and drive technical reviews with design and architecture teams while incorporating security activities within test plans to ensure security coverage.

Additionally, you'll maintain and improve existing functional verification infrastructure and methodology, absorb learning from postsilicon validation quality, update test plans for missing coverages, and proliferate improvements to future products.
